Fine Aggregates: The fine aggregate which was used was locally available river sand, which passed through 4.75 mm. Result of sieve analysis of fine aggregate is given in Table 2. The specific gravity of fine aggregate is 2.65 and fineness modulus is 2.67. Bulk density of fine aggregates is 1.29 and compacted bulk density is 1.48.

Concrete Cloth is a flexible, cement impregnated fabric that hardens on hydration to form a thin, durable, waterproof and fire resistant layer. History of Concrete Cloth The British Army just placed a sizeable order for an innovative new material that combines the flexibility of fabric with the structural performance of concrete.
